Full Description
This exam centers on the mathematical and theoretical foundations involved in optimizing trajectories for both aircraft and spacecraft missions. Emphasis is placed on orbital mechanics, dynamics, and control theory.
Understanding trajectory optimization is essential for effective mission planning, as it directly influences mission costs, operational risks, and resource allocation. This knowledge is crucial for both academic research and practical aerospace applications.
The exam will assess the ability to articulate principles of trajectory analysis and the implications of varying parameters during mission planning. Candidates will be expected to demonstrate their grasp of relevant concepts and analytical techniques.
Students should prepare to discuss key theories and mathematical models used in trajectory optimization, illustrated with real-world aerospace mission scenarios.
